What are the responsibilities and job description for the ETL Developer position at HP Infosystem LLC.?
- Analyze, design, and develop ETL packages on SSIS.
- Design, develop, deploy and maintain reports on SSRS.
- Some exposure to Designing and developing dashboard on Power BI and/or Tableau.
- Design, develop, deploy and maintain dimensional models in SSAS cube and tabular model is a plus.
- Evaluate, design, propose, and secure approval for all design and implementation.
- Evaluate, design, and maintain multiple database environments; identify data sources, construct data decomposition diagrams, provide data flow diagrams and document the process; write codes for database access, modifications and constructions including stored procedures and database server configuration.
- Develop and maintain procedures and scripts for recreating the database environment and databases for disaster recovery purposes and business continuity strategy.
- Develop complex Script tasks (using C# or VB.NET) in SSIS to handle File System Objects.
- Design, develop, and integrate reporting/dashboard solutions on MS SharePoint.
- Administer database systems technical design, performance monitoring and tuning, backup and recovery, data and file distribution, reporting, database upgrades, integrations, migrations and conversions.
- Design and implement OLTP and OLAP data models.
- Develop and maintain database administration procedures and operations; cross train on, and provide operational support of, procedures.
- Design, implement, and support data warehousing - implement business rules via stored procedures, middleware or other technologies; define user interfaces and functional specifications.
- Responsible for verifying accuracy of data in dashboards, reports, data extracts and data warehouse.
- Monitor system details within the data warehouse, including stored procedures and execution time, and implement efficiency improvements.
- Troubleshoot and resolve data quality issues, database performance issues, database capacity issues, replication and other distributed data issues.
- Resolve database performance issues by looking at query plans, create appropriate indexes, resolve dead locks and create table hints.
- Troubleshoot and resolve issues in reports, dashboards and ETL packages.
- Closely work with other IT teams including Analysts and Product Managers to troubleshoot, modify and enhance existing BI assets.
- Develop, implement, and maintain change control and testing processes for modifications to databases.
- Participate in assigned roles in project teams.
- Follow the organization’s data protection and network securities and antivirus policies.
- Stay abreast of industry trends, and attend training, conferences and seminars according to organization’s business requirements.
- Participate in Credit Union training and development programs.
- Perform additional responsibilities as assigned.
What we''re seeking
- Bachelor’s degree in Engineering or Computer Science
- 6 years of experience in reports and data warehouse development
- 5 years software development experience on Microsoft BI Platform – SSAS, SSRS, MS SQL Server
- 4 years of experience in DB Development using MS SQL
- 2 years of experience using Oracle Business Intelligence tools
- 2 years of experience in Data Migration from various systems to SQL Server Database
- 2 years of experience in building Data Marts using dimensional models
- 2 years of experience in building Dashboards and KPI visualization on Power BI and/or Tableau
- 2 years of supporting a Data Warehouse environment
- 1 year experience using Oracle PL/SQL
PLUS TO HAVE
- Knowledge of Data encryption tools and standards
- Experience in the following areas:
- Maintaining code/scripts in TFS for multiple environments
- Cloud technology like Microsoft Azure.
- Data Technologies like MongoDB, NoSQL, SnowFlake, DataBricks.
- DBA activities like database backup and restore.
- Hands on working experience in Linux/Unix Environment.
- XML
- Web Services
- Knowledge of financial/banking industry
Salary : $106,000 - $142,000